Как следать сопровождающего бота?

Perdimonocle
Offline
Зарегистрирован: 19.10.2012

Есть готовый бот, объезжающий препятствия, ездящий по линии и т.д.

Теперь появилась идея, чтобы бот следовал за мной на расстоянии, например, 2-3 метра...

Вопрос: как реализовать, чтобы он "преследовал" именно меня?

Кроме RFID-меток ничего в мою голову не приходит...

Araris
Offline
Зарегистрирован: 09.11.2012

RFID-метки на расстоянии 2-3 метра - нереально.

В мою голову приходит Bluetooth-маячок на ведущем, но вот как определять направление на него...

А может инфракрасный маячок ?..

vvadim
Offline
Зарегистрирован: 23.05.2012

дык всё просто

на объекте гироскоп, аксель и компас.
определяете своё положение и передаёте боту.
на боте те же компоненты.
он отслеживает положение и движется к объекту на каком то удалении.

думаю тыщ за 100 кто то сможет реализовать эту задачу....

Gippopotam
Gippopotam аватар
Offline
Зарегистрирован: 12.09.2014

vvadim пишет:

дык всё просто

на объекте гироскоп, аксель и компас.
определяете своё положение ...

Думаете это реально?

Gippopotam
Gippopotam аватар
Offline
Зарегистрирован: 12.09.2014

Araris пишет:

В мою голову приходит Bluetooth-маячок на ведущем, но вот как определять направление на него...

Модули умеют определять уровень сигнала. Но у меня ничего путного сделать не получилось.

Может если дольше повозиться, поставить несколько трансиверов, разведенных в пространстве, типа локаторов - может что и получится...
Но я подозреваю, что нереально.

vvadim
Offline
Зарегистрирован: 23.05.2012

вполне возможно

по этой связке (гиро, аксель, магн. компас) определить координату в пространстве и передать её на бот

но с математикой и прогой чайнику типа меня не справится (хотя если поставить цель и упереться....)

vvadim
Offline
Зарегистрирован: 23.05.2012

тут на самом деле вопрос в другом - серьёзная мозговая работа ради маленькой хотелки (есть ли смысл?)

Duino A.R.
Offline
Зарегистрирован: 25.05.2015

Araris пишет:
А может инфракрасный маячок ?..

В моем пионерском детстве были популярны простые игрушки, бегающие за фонариком. Вся логика из двух фотореле. Здесь можно добавить УЗ-дальномер, чтобы на ноги не наступал. Если нужно отследить не единственный маячок, промодулировать его известной частотой. Для игрушки должно хватить функционала. Да и сложность реализации обещает быть весьма умеренной.

vvadim
Offline
Зарегистрирован: 23.05.2012

если ходить и светить на бота- тогда можно

а если посветить в сторону?

Клапауций 070
Offline
Зарегистрирован: 26.09.2015

Gippopotam
Gippopotam аватар
Offline
Зарегистрирован: 12.09.2014

Я хотел шнурок предложить, но побоялся, что будет слишком технологично.

 

Согласен с vvadim:

vvadim пишет:

тут на самом деле вопрос в другом - серьёзная мозговая работа ради маленькой хотелки (есть ли смысл?)

хотелка сродни мотошлему с дополненной реальностью.

Duino A.R.
Offline
Зарегистрирован: 25.05.2015

vvadim пишет:

если ходить и светить на бота- тогда можно

а если посветить в сторону?

Специально светить на бота не нужно. Просто маячок нужен с широкой диаграммой направленности. Раньше с такой задачей прекрасно справлялась лампа от фонарика, только без самого фонарика. Или фонарик со снятым отражателем. :) Ввернуть лампочку в... гм... заднюю полусферу и... пусть светит. Если светодиоды, то лучше без фокусирующих линз. У них диаграмма все равно уже, чем у лампы, поэтому потребуется несколько штук. Нормально работало.

Sloper
Sloper аватар
Offline
Зарегистрирован: 30.03.2015

А если поставить беспроводные модули на человека и на бот. На бот - 2 штуки- вперед и назад. И мерять разницу во времени получения отклика от них? Узнаем направление. А по силе сигнала - удаление?

 

 

Клапауций 070
Offline
Зарегистрирован: 26.09.2015

Sloper пишет:

А если поставить беспроводные модули на человека и на бот. На бот - 2 штуки- вперед и назад. И мерять разницу во времени получения отклика от них? Узнаем направление. А по силе сигнала - удаление?

могу подогнать противоминомётный радар

Araris
Offline
Зарегистрирован: 09.11.2012

Мерять разницу во времени. Sloper, известно ли Вам, с какой скоростью распространяются радиоволны ? 

Клапауций 070
Offline
Зарегистрирован: 26.09.2015

Araris пишет:

Sloper, известно ли Вам, с какой скоростью распространяются радиоволны ? 

пусть у противоминомётного радара голова болит на тему скорости радиоволн.

Perdimonocle
Offline
Зарегистрирован: 19.10.2012

В общем, здравых идей ни у кого из "сидящих" на форуме, кроме Duino A.R., не появилось.

Постебались и разошлись...

bwn
Offline
Зарегистрирован: 25.08.2014

Perdimonocle пишет:

В общем, здравых идей ни у кого из "сидящих" на форуме, кроме Duino A.R., не появилось.

Постебались и разошлись...

Так нет их простых то. А  сложные никому для такой задачи не нужны. Лампочка тоже хороша, пока более мощный источник в поле видимости не появился.

Duino A.R.
Offline
Зарегистрирован: 25.05.2015

bwn пишет:

Лампочка тоже хороша, пока более мощный источник в поле видимости не появился.


Для "пионерского" варианта - да. Там, кто сильнее засветил, к тому и едут. Если помеха не вводит в насыщение сам приемник и электронику за ним, то отстроиться от нее, как и от другого маячка, относительно просто, промодулировав его частотой. Учитывая электромеханическую сущность бота, модуляцию можно сделать на частоте всего в несколько десятков герц. Такую частоту и в излучатель просто засунуть и выделить потом программным методом. Главное, чтобы она не пересекалась с 50 Гц и их гармониками, иначе лампы дневного света все забьют.

bwn
Offline
Зарегистрирован: 25.08.2014

Duino A.R. пишет:
bwn пишет:

Лампочка тоже хороша, пока более мощный источник в поле видимости не появился.

Для "пионерского" варианта - да. Там, кто сильнее засветил, к тому и едут. Если помеха не вводит в насыщение сам приемник и электронику за ним, то отстроиться от нее, как и от другого маячка, относительно просто, промодулировав его частотой. Учитывая электромеханическую сущность бота, модуляцию можно сделать на частоте всего в несколько десятков герц. Такую частоту и в излучатель просто засунуть и выделить потом программным методом. Главное, чтобы она не пересекалась с 50 Гц и их гармониками, иначе лампы дневного света все забьют.

Так и говорю, чем дальше, тем сложнее. Солнышко напротив, скорее всего ослепит полностью, резкий поворот объекта преследования, введет преследователя в ступор и т.д.

griin
Offline
Зарегистрирован: 19.04.2015

камера и инфрамаячок, погугли кто-то экспереминировал с камерой и ардуиной

Duino A.R.
Offline
Зарегистрирован: 25.05.2015

bwn пишет:

Так и говорю, чем дальше, тем сложнее.

Бесспорно. Ни о каких "настоящих" системах здесь и речи быть не может. Игрушка вплоть до прикола со шнурком "от Gippopotam". Кстати, если "веревочку" обыграть должным образом, эмоционально это может оказаться забавнее хитромудрой электроники.

Есть еще несколько способов, связанных с оптической локацией, имеющих вполне умеренную сложность, но никак не "два пальца об асфальт". :)

bwn пишет:

Солнышко напротив, скорее всего ослепит полностью...

Да. До сих пор, кто жить хочет, стараются от Солнца заходить. Противу Солнышка никто не пляшет.

bwn пишет:

резкий поворот объекта преследования, введет преследователя в ступор и т.д.

Если объект преследования имеет заднюю полусферу, достойную преследования, то, действительно, резкий поворот ею  может ввести преследователя в ступор. Хотя... настоящий преследователь при этом стремится сразу перейти к "и т.д.". :)

Sloper
Sloper аватар
Offline
Зарегистрирован: 30.03.2015

У меня часы ищут Айфон дома. Показывают на сколько я удален от него. Так и ищу, по индикатору удаления. Подключены по блютуту. Может так попробовать?

olegtur77
Offline
Зарегистрирован: 09.04.2015

Функция есть в коптере фантом, называется Follow me ,  эта    же функция поддерживается ардупилотом http://copter.ardupilot.com/wiki/ac2_followme/     и           https://3drobotics.com/kb/follow-instructions/  ,  АПМ(ардупилот, ардукоаптер)  это аруина 2560 с набором датчиков 10DOF. или же упрощенная версия AIOP v2.0 (прошивка Мегапират)

Gippopotam
Gippopotam аватар
Offline
Зарегистрирован: 12.09.2014

olegtur77 пишет:

Функция есть в коптере фантом, называется Follow me ,  эта    же функция поддерживается ардупилотом http://copter.ardupilot.com/wiki/ac2_followme/     и           https://3drobotics.com/kb/follow-instructions/  ,  АПМ(ардупилот, ардукоаптер)  это аруина 2560 с набором датчиков 10DOF. или же упрощенная версия AIOP v2.0 (прошивка Мегапират)

порядок расстояний и количество степеней свобод разное.

Gride
Gride аватар
Offline
Зарегистрирован: 09.11.2015

https://youtu.be/gr9KvOkNum8

Буржуи уже испозуют.